Save Online Creative Expression from FCC 'Pay-2-Play' Regulations

Stop giant corporate alliances with the FCC from passing a law to turn the Internet into a 'pay to play' environment. It will kill the business of indie bloggers, musicians, artists, craftsmen, designers and videographers.

Why is this important?

For four years my daughter Keelan and I have programmed and operated a free access showcase website and an eco-friendly fashion blog that introduce and promote unknown and emerging artists globally. Our business is small and we charge no fees to artists who wish to showcase their new projects. Therefore, our operation struggles and survives on advertising revenues and some online art sales.

If the FCC passes a law that would limit small website promoters such as vodwall.com and kikiculture.com, then our websites will not be able to compete and survive in a non-net neutrality Internet world. Further, there will be limited outlets for new artists to freely exhibit their art, writings, music and creative projects without having to pay a fee to exhibit their endeavors.
